Subject: [PATCH] net: Add parameter checks for VLAN clients (Jan Kiszka)

This aims at helping the user to find typos or other mistakes in
parameter lists passed for VLAN client initialization. The existing
parsing infrastructure does not allow a leaner approach, but this is
better than nothing IMHO.
